1. Classic Black Gothic Vibes

10 October Nails Ideas Short Are All You Need for Autumn Vibes

There's nothing quite like black nails in October. Short, square-shaped nails in deep matte black or glossy jet black scream gothic glam. They're sleek, sophisticated, and absolutely perfect for Halloween—or for anyone channeling Wednesday Addams vibes.

For a bolder twist, try accenting one or two nails with tiny silver crosses, crescent moons, or stars. I've tried this design on myself with a matte top coat and it always turns heads. It's the kind of look that works whether you're carving pumpkins or out on the town.

Pro Tip: Use nail stickers or stamps for quick and precise gothic detailing.

2. Autumn-Toned French Tips

French tips have gone through a glow-up—and fall is the perfect time to get creative. Swap out the traditional white tips for warm, seasonal colors like burnt orange, mustard, cinnamon brown, or burgundy.

Keep your nails short and go with a square or almond shape depending on your personal style. I love pairing a nude or clear base with coppery tips—it looks classy but with that fall flair.

This is one of the best October nails ideas short lovers can try if you want something subtle, polished, and work-appropriate, yet seasonal.

3. Cute Pink and Pumpkin Combo

Who says fall can’t be feminine? Pink may not be the typical autumn hue, but paired with soft pumpkin designs, it becomes irresistibly cute.

A blush or nude pink base with tiny pumpkin or leaf accents on one or two nails keeps it playful without being over the top. I tried this look last fall and even strangers commented on how adorable it was!

It’s a fresh, modern twist on fall nail art—great if you want something unique yet still autumn-inspired.

4. Minimalist Almond-Shaped Fall Florals

There’s a quiet elegance in minimal nail designs. Short almond nails with hand-drawn or sticker florals in autumn hues—think terracotta, olive green, and maroon—can be breathtaking.

This is for those who love subtle beauty. I once wore this look to a fall wedding, and it was the perfect blend of classy and seasonal. Pair it with a cozy cardigan, and you’re fall-photo ready.

5. Short Square Halloween Nails

October wouldn't be complete without a fun Halloween mani. Keep things short and sweet with square nails featuring mini ghosts, candy corn, or cobwebs.

Opt for a nude base to keep it chic, and let your accent nails do the talking. This is a great way to participate in the Halloween spirit without going full costume-mode.

6. Acrylic Short Nails with Plaid Design

Short acrylic nails are sturdy and ideal if you want something lasting through the season. Add a trendy plaid pattern in orange, mustard, or forest green for that warm, cozy fall look.

You can alternate the plaid with solid nails in coordinating shades for a balanced finish. Bonus: plaid designs pair beautifully with scarves and boots for full-on autumn aesthetic.

7. Gothic French Tips

Combine the elegance of a French mani with the edge of goth vibes by using black for the tips instead of white. This twist is sleek, stylish, and unexpectedly seasonal.

Add a tiny bat or spiderweb decal on an accent nail to make it scream October. I’ve done this design with both matte and glossy finishes—both are equally captivating!

It’s one of the classiest and most gothic October nail styles for short nails you can wear with confidence.

8. Gel Nails with Dusty Autumn Colors

Fall nail colors are all about mood: dusty rose, sage green, smoky purple, and cinnamon brown. These muted gel shades are chic, timeless, and super wearable.

Whether you go with an almond or square shape, keeping them short ensures they stay functional for everyday life.

This is my personal go-to October nail look when I want something simple but not boring. A glossy topcoat brings out the richness of these gel shades beautifully.

9. Classy Nude Nails with Gold Foil

Sometimes less is more. Nude nails with a touch of gold foil bring effortless class. The gold shimmers like autumn leaves in the sun—making it perfect for both day and evening events.

This style works beautifully on almond-shaped nails and is ideal for short nails as the foil adds detail without clutter.

When I wore this look to a fall dinner party, it became the main topic of conversation at the table!

10. Short Pink Halloween-Inspired Nails

Yes, pink can totally work for Halloween! Go for a soft pink base and add cute Halloween art like baby ghosts, cobweb hearts, or candy details.

This is one of my favorite looks because it merges girly and spooky perfectly. It’s fun, creative, and Instagram-worthy.

If you’re looking for October nails ideas short that are cute, fun, and just a little spooky—this is the one to try.
